Loading presentation...

Present Remotely

Send the link below via email or IM

Copy

Present to your audience

Start remote presentation

  • Invited audience members will follow you as you navigate and present
  • People invited to a presentation do not need a Prezi account
  • This link expires 10 minutes after you close the presentation
  • A maximum of 30 users can follow your presentation
  • Learn more about this feature in our knowledge base article

Do you really want to delete this prezi?

Neither you, nor the coeditors you shared it with will be able to recover it again.

DeleteCancel

Make your likes visible on Facebook?

Connect your Facebook account to Prezi and let your likes appear on your timeline.
You can change this under Settings & Account at any time.

No, thanks

2.4 Esquemas de Firmas DSA Firmas Digitales.

No description
by

Mayra Beltran

on 26 May 2016

Comments (0)

Please log in to add your comment.

Report abuse

Transcript of 2.4 Esquemas de Firmas DSA Firmas Digitales.

2.4 Esquemas de Firmas DSA Firmas Digitales.
Origen del Algoritmo.
DSA
(Digital Signature Algorithm
, en español Algoritmo de Firma digital) es un estándar del Gobierno Federal de los Estados Unidos de América o FIPS para firmas digitales. Fue un Algoritmo propuesto por el Instituto Nacional de Normas y Tecnología de los Estados Unidos para su uso en su Estándar de Firma Digital (DSS), especificado en el FIPS 186. DSA se hizo público el 30 de agosto de 1991, este algoritmo como su nombre lo indica, sirve para firmar y no para cifrar información. Una desventaja de este algoritmo es que requiere mucho más tiempo de cómputo que RSA.
Su Funcionamiento.
El funcionamiento de DSA se divide en 3 etapas. Generación de claves, firma y verificación. Las dos primeras las realiza el emisor y la última el receptor.
Parametros.

x
: CLAVE PRIVADA DEL REMITENTE

Parametros.
2. En la Firma:

k
: Número pseudoaleatorio único para cada firma
s
: Valor que corresponde a la firma
r
: Valor de comprobación de la firma

3. En la verificacion:

w
: Valor que se requiere en el descifrado de la firma
u1
: Dato relativo al valor del hash del mensaje en claro
u2
: Dato relativo a la Integridad de la firma
v
: Valor de comprobación y verificación de firma
1. En la generacion de claves: Los datos son publicos excepto X.
p
: Número primo de 512 bits de longitud como mínimo
q
: Número primo de 160 bits de longitud
y
: CLAVE PÚBLICA DEL REMITENTE
g
: Parámetro utilizado para calcular la clave pública
Algoritmo DSA
El Digital Signature Algorithm es un algoritmo de sifrado asimetrico o de clave publica. Con esta clase que utiliza el algoritmo DSA Podemos verificar la autenticidad de un mensaje dada una clave publica y la firma del mensaje. Tambien podemos generar pares claves publicas, privadas y generar firma de datos usando la clave privada generada.
Full transcript